The instructor will report to the Transportation Program Director and will be responsible for classroom and hands‑on operational instruction of students in the Heavy Equipment Operator Program. The role is a temporary, part‑time faculty appointment on a semester basis, with a limit of 9 credit hours per semester unless approved otherwise.
Major Duties- Collaborate with department members on program and curriculum development.
- Maintain a record system for student achievement and deliver customized training for local industry.
- Complete instructor training provided by the National Center for Construction Education and Research.
- Prepare and teach courses in both classroom settings and at dig sites, delivering lectures, assignments, and tests.
- Evaluate and record student performance and teach hands‑on driving skills on college‑provided heavy equipment.
- Tutor, mentor, and serve as an exemplary model of professionalism for students.
- Submit grades by the deadline and assess course and program‑level learning outcomes.
- Maintain course documentation such as syllabi, tests, and lesson plans.
- Resolve student issues and concerns or refer them to the Transportation Program Director.
- Perform related duties as assigned.
- High school diploma or GED with a minimum of seven (7) years of industry experience as a heavy equipment operator.
- Associate degree with five (5) years of experience primarily as a heavy equipment operator.
- Current Class A CDL license and demonstrable teaching ability (highly desirable).
- Valid driver’s license for the type of vehicle or equipment operated issued by the State of New Mexico.
- Must pass a drug screening test and successfully complete a Defensive Driving Course.
- Ability to teach on a semester basis; not more than 9 credit hours per semester without special approval.
